[REQ] Can we check the sensors for escorts?
 
I know some modders have inspected the sensor configurations of US subs, trying to fix radar issues, etc.

Has anyone had a look at the sensors for Japanese ships, namely destroyers and other escorts?

Based on discussions in the main forum and my own experience, it appears that on the surface Japanese destroyers always see you first, as if they had super lookouts or radar turned on. I always spot them headed right at me like they knew I was there long before they became visible.

I'm worried that either their visual compability is mistakenly parameterized or they actually have radar (which they shouldn't).

Jace11 04-22-07 11:15 AM

how do the fog modifiers work. I see some sim.cfg files people have modded and they have increased this:

[Visual]
Detection time=0.25 ;[s] min detection time.
Sensitivity=0.01 ;(0..1) at (sensitivity * max range) we have a double detection time.
Fog factor=2.0 ;[>=0]
Light factor=2.25 ;[>=0]
Waves factor=1.0 ;[>=0]
Enemy surface factor=150 ;[m2]
Enemy speed factor=8 ;[kt]
Thermal Layer Signal Attenuation=1.0

The fog factor, and all these other variables..

Det time = easy.. second until detection
Sensitivity.. = scales detection time to range..
Fog factor = ?? Higher = AI finds it harder to see in fog.. or easier
Light factor = ?? Daylight? 2.25 = easier...
Waves = rough sea effect but changing this # up or down makes it harder or easier?

surface factor = must be size of target - larger easier to spot...

Bad news.

It appears that escorts (at least in the 1943 photo recon mission I tested) have radar enabled. Borking the radar in the sim.cfg file leads to normal visual detection behavior (I see them before they see me). I'll start a new thread to address this.
